Pass the Grogger is a game by Gontza Games, the creators of Christmas Cards.. Gontza Games was created by Ann Stolinsky. She loves games so much that she has game nights with her friends once a month. She created her own games because she wanted to share her love of gaming with others. She also makes it a point to have all of her games made in the USA.

Pass the Grogger is a great game for a mutli-age household. It is suggested for ages 4 to 10. The game has a simple premise. During game play, you take turns selecting cards and making matches of people and items related to Purim, a Jewish holiday.  The winner is based on a scoring system. There are two scoring systems, based on age. (I love that I can change the difficulty level based on who’s playing.)
